A fire at a derelict hotel in Newquay
is believed to have been an arson attack, Cornwall's fire service says.
Emergency crews were sent to the four-storey former Cedars Hotel in the Mount Wise area at about 16:30 GMT on Wednesday.
About 30 people were evacuated from neighbouring properties which were affected by smoke in what police declared a major incident.
Residents were later allowed to return home. No injuries were reported.
Newquay station manager Stuart Whitworth said: "It's a derelict property and there's no power to it, so we can be fairly confident this is arson."
